1. Understanding the Gut Microbiome
Your microbiome is primarily located in your large intestine and contains more bacterial cells than you have human cells. This microbiome ecosystem:
-
Supports digestion by breaking down fibres and carbohydrates
-
Produces essential nutrients, including vitamin K2, biotin, B12, and folate
-
Shapes immune function, interacting with 70–80% of your immune system
-
Protects the gut barrier, which helps maintain intestinal integrity
-
Influences metabolism, satiety, and blood sugar balance
-
Communicates with your brain via the gut–brain axis, producing neurotransmitters such as serotonin
A diverse microbiome tends to be more resilient, adaptable, and beneficial.

What Disrupts the Microbiome?
Factors that can compromise gut balance include:
-
Diets high in sugar and processed foods
-
Low-fibre intake
-
Alcohol excess
-
Chronic stress
-
Poor sleep quality
-
Environmental toxins
-
Sedentary behaviour
-
Certain medications (including antibiotics)
The good news: the microbiome is incredibly responsive. Even small, consistent changes can shift it in a positive direction within days to weeks.

2. Probiotics: Beneficial Bacteria That Support Your Gut
Probiotics are live microorganisms that, when consumed in adequate amounts, contribute to beneficial microbial balance. Different probiotic strains have different actions, so matching the strain to the goal is key.
Notable Lactobacillus Strains
-
Lactobacillus acidophilus – supports digestion and immunity
-
L. rhamnosus GG – well studied; helpful during antibiotic use
-
L. plantarum – supports gut barrier integrity and reduces bloating
-
L. casei – helpful for regularity
-
L. reuteri – supports oral health and gut–brain communication
Notable Bifidobacterium Strains
-
Bifidobacterium longum – supports stress response and digestion
-
B. bifidum – helpful for immune function
-
B. breve – supports digestive comfort and skin health
-
B. lactis – enhances regularity and immune balance
Other Important Organisms
-
Saccharomyces boulardii – a beneficial yeast that supports gut resilience
-
Streptococcus thermophilus – supports dairy digestion
Choosing a Probiotic
Look for:
-
A clear list of strains
-
Evidence-based organisms
-
1–10+ billion CFU
-
Proven survivability
-
Third-party testing
-
Storage instructions (refrigerated or shelf-stable)
Consistency is more important than timing, though many strains work well taken with meals.
3. Prebiotics: Feeding Your Good Bacteria
Prebiotics are non-digestible fibres that feed beneficial bacteria. They help your gut produce short-chain fatty acids (SCFAs) such as butyrate, which support gut lining integrity, metabolic health, and inflammatory balance.
Top Prebiotic Sources
-
Garlic, onions, leeks
-
Asparagus
-
Bananas (slightly green for more resistant starch)
-
Apples
-
Oats
-
Beans, chickpeas, lentils
-
Flaxseeds, chia seeds
-
Jerusalem artichokes
-
Cooked-and-cooled potatoes/rice (resistant starch)
Aim for 5–10 grams of prebiotic fibre daily.

5. Fermented Foods: Nature’s Probiotics
Fermented foods naturally supply live cultures and can be easier to incorporate into daily life than supplements.
Top fermented foods include:
-
Yogurt (unsweetened, live cultures)
-
Kefir
-
Sauerkraut
-
Kimchi
-
Miso
-
Tempeh
-
Kombucha
-
Raw apple cider vinegar
Start slow and aim for 1–2 servings daily, rotating varieties for microbial diversity.
6. Postbiotics: The Beneficial Byproducts
Postbiotics are compounds produced by your microbiome. These include:
-
Short-chain fatty acids (butyrate, acetate, propionate)
-
Vitamins such as B12, folate, and K2
-
Antimicrobial compounds that protect against harmful organisms
-
Enzymes that aid digestion
You boost postbiotic production by:
-
Eating diverse plant fibres
-
Consuming fermented foods
-
Including resistant starch
-
Supporting a healthy microbiome environment
7. Lifestyle Habits That Improve Gut Health
Lifestyle influences the microbiome just as profoundly as diet.
Stress Management
Chronic stress changes microbiome composition. Helpful approaches include:
-
Meditation
-
Breathwork
-
Time outdoors
-
Gentle exercise
-
Mindfulness practices
Sleep Quality
A healthy microbiome promotes better sleep—and vice versa.
Aim for 7–9 hours, reduce screens before bed, and keep your room cool and dark.
Physical Activity
Exercise increases microbial diversity and enhances beneficial bacteria.
Combine cardio, strength training, and regular movement throughout the day.
Hydration
Water supports digestion, mucosal lining health, and microbial balance.
Smart Antibiotic Use
Only use antibiotics when necessary, and support your gut afterward with probiotics and fermented foods.
Reduce Toxin Burden
Choose whole foods, filter water, and limit artificial additives and unnecessary medications.
